linux--cut命令
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了linux--cut命令相关的知识,希望对你有一定的参考价值。
cut命令:在文件的每一行中提取片断
cut [OPTION]... [FILE]...
描述 (DESCRIPTION)
在 每个文件 FILE 的 各行 中, 把 提取的 片断 显示在 标准输出.
-b, --bytes=LIST
输出 这些 字节
实例:
[[email protected] ~]# cat /etc/gshadow |cut -b 1-5
root:
bin::
daemo
sys::
adm::
tty::
-c, --characters=LIST
输出 这些 字符
实例:
[[email protected] ~]# cat /etc/gshadow |cut -c 1,3,5
ro:
bn:
deo
ss:
am:
ty:
-d, --delimiter=DELIM
使用 DELIM 取代 TAB 做 字段(field) 分隔符
-f, --fields=LIST
输出 这些 字段
实例:
以冒号分隔,取出/etc/passwd文件的第6至第10行
[[email protected] ~]# cat /etc/passwd |cut -d : -f 6-10
/root:/bin/bash
/bin:/sbin/nologin
/sbin:/sbin/nologin
/var/adm:/sbin/nologin
/var/spool/lpd:/sbin/nologin
/sbin:/bin/sync
/sbin:/sbin/shutdown
以上是关于linux--cut命令的主要内容,如果未能解决你的问题,请参考以下文章